Find Your Passion: Community Partners in Caring to Host Santa Maria Valley Volunteer Fair
SANTA MARIA, CA — Are you looking for a way to give back but aren't sure where to start?
Community Partners in Caring and the City of Santa Maria invites the public to the Santa Maria Valley Volunteer Fair on Saturday, April 19th, from 12:00 PM to 3:00 PM at the Town Center Mall in the Upper Regal Mezzanine.
This free community event is designed to bridge the gap between passionate residents and local organizations in need of support. Attendees will have the unique opportunity to meet face-to-face with representatives from a diverse range of nonprofits, allowing them to explore various causes and find the perfect fit for their skills and schedule.
Whether you are interested in helping animals, supporting seniors, mentoring children, or preserving nature, the fair will showcase a wide variety of opportunities to volunteer. From one-time event help to ongoing weekly commitments, there is a capacity for everyone to make a difference.
"Many people want to help their neighbors and community, but feel overwhelmed by the options or don't know who to call" said Midge Nicosia, event organizer. "This event will have many options to choose from in one room, making it easy to discover exactly where your talents are needed most."
Event Details:
What: Santa Maria Valley Volunteer Fair
When: April 19th, 12:00 PM – 3:00 PM
Where: Town Center Mall, Upper Regal Mezzanine, Santa Maria
Cost: Free to the public

About Community Partners in Caring: Community Partners in Caring is a nonprofit dedicated to coordinating volunteer support
services that allow seniors to live independently while maintaining their dignity and quality of life.
